Transaction 1774060c02d4259f7bed16a8c0af76ba569bb09f4dd52326729f43bf749ba84b

1 Input
2 Outputs
  • 1774060c02d4259f7bed16a8c0af76ba569bb09f4dd52326729f43bf749ba84b:0
  • value  123969329
    address  3HzvtNgBdQWPCji71Z9auqsJhi1w4n7CYg
  • 1774060c02d4259f7bed16a8c0af76ba569bb09f4dd52326729f43bf749ba84b:1
  • value  2027430
    address  3KjUZZuPSCS4zyQEHPem1pPGenXSZ7WxRt